The Importance Of Regular Boiler Checks

A boiler is an essential part of any home or building that provides heat and hot water. It works by heating water which is then distributed throughout the building to keep it warm. Like any other appliance, boilers require regular maintenance to ensure they are working efficiently and safely. One crucial aspect of boiler maintenance is the boiler check.

A boiler check is a thorough inspection of the boiler system to ensure that it is functioning properly and safely. This involves checking for any signs of wear and tear, leaks, or other potential issues that could lead to a breakdown or even a dangerous situation. Regular boiler checks are essential for the following reasons:

1. Safety: The safety of your home or building is of utmost importance, and a faulty boiler can pose a serious risk. A boiler check can identify any potential safety hazards such as gas leaks, carbon monoxide leaks, or other issues that could lead to fire or explosion. By regularly checking your boiler, you can prevent these hazards and keep your home safe.

2. Efficiency: A well-maintained boiler operates more efficiently, which means it will use less energy to heat your home. This not only saves you money on your energy bills but also reduces your carbon footprint. A boiler check can identify any issues that may be causing your boiler to work harder than necessary, such as dirty filters or faulty components.

3. Longevity: Regular boiler checks can prolong the life of your boiler by identifying and addressing any potential issues before they escalate. By keeping your boiler well-maintained, you can avoid costly repairs or the need for a premature replacement. This saves you money in the long run and ensures your boiler will continue to provide you with heat and hot water for years to come.

4. Warranty: Many boiler manufacturers require regular maintenance in order to maintain the warranty on your boiler. Failure to adhere to these requirements could void your warranty, leaving you responsible for any repairs or replacements out of pocket. By scheduling regular boiler checks, you can ensure that your warranty remains valid and protect yourself from unexpected expenses.

To perform a boiler check, it is recommended to hire a qualified professional who is trained to inspect and maintain boiler systems. A professional boiler technician will have the knowledge and experience to identify any potential issues and make any necessary repairs or adjustments. They will also be able to provide you with valuable advice on how to keep your boiler running smoothly between checks.

During a boiler check, the technician will inspect the various components of the boiler, including the burner, heat exchanger, flue, and controls. They will check for any signs of wear and tear, leaks, or other issues that could impact the performance of the boiler. The technician will also test the boiler’s efficiency and safety features to ensure they are functioning properly.

In addition to a professional boiler check, there are some simple steps you can take to keep your boiler running smoothly between checks. These include bleeding radiators to remove air bubbles, checking the pressure gauge, and keeping the area around the boiler clear of clutter. Regularly checking your boiler for signs of issues, such as strange noises or unusual smells, can also help you catch potential problems early.
